Mask Wearing Mandate Lifted

DCMO BOCES to school mandate for wearing masks 


In compliance with Governor Hochul’s decision to lift the mask mandates for New York schools effective March 2, 2022, DCMO BOCES will end the mandatory wearing of masks for students, staff, and visitors effective March 2nd.  The Governor’s decision follows the Centers for Disease Control (CDC) new guidelines based on state metrics for tracking the COVID-19 pandemic.  District Superintendent Perry T. Dewey commented, “Everyone retains their right to wear a mask, and DCMO BOCES will be vigilant to share the organization’s commitment to respecting people’s right to self-protection.”  Dewey added that the Health and Safety team has prepared to distribute additional masks and test kits to staff, students, and visitors who wish to continue their personal protection.


According to Jason Lawrence, Health and Safety Officer for DCMO BOCES, cleaning and sanitizing protocols will remain in place.  “Processes are in place to maintain health and safety protocols to sanitize and clean all facilities.  We will continue to work closely with everyone to help them find comfort with this decision by providing protective supplies and testing resources,” said Lawrence.
